Just a note:
I have pulled a pump back out after it was changed in a friends car. I found that he had not hooked the the rubber transfer hose up very well. I guess after starting a few times the pressure blew it off. Anyway I reconnected the line and no problems for 2 years now.
The reason I pulled the pump was fuel pressure was very low when he brought it to me...
Really need to check your pressure
